Before my training session I like to get to know the player. I like to learn their strengths and their weaknesses and typically what position they play on their school or AAU team. Also I like to learn as much as I can about the type of plays their teams run and the type of shots they usually get in the midst of a game. Once I learn these things I design a workout that will specifically benefit that player. If the player is a ball handler on their team we work on ball handling first and then we work on shooting off the dribble and floaters around the rim. Also, since the game today involves so many pick and rolls i will work on players decision making in the pick and roll. Everything depends on the player. The more advanced the player is the more advanced and difficult the drills are. Additionally, if the player is a beginner the drills will focus on the fundamentals. Typically, regardless of your position and/or ability my sessions always involve getting shots up and learning to be a better and more consistent shooter. Whether being a better shooting means speeding up your release, expanding your range, and/or footwork I have the drills and expertise to help you. I myself am a guard though that is known to be a shooter so helping players develop a better shot and ball handle is where I thrive. Also, I like to do a lot of skill work that involves conditioning. I'll never have a player flat out doing sprints. When you workout with me, if you're running, you're running in between shots. If you are jumping, you are jumping to finish at the rim or if you can, to dunk. Everything is to help you excel in game situations so you are prepared for any situation that may arise in a game.
